The cheapest way to get from Lisbon to Sierra de Gata (Land) is to bus via Villanueva de la Serena which costs €65 - €130 and takes 10h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Lisbon to Sierra de Gata (Land) is to drive which takes 5h 35m and costs €75 - €110.
No, there is no direct bus from Lisbon to Sierra de Gata (Land). However, there are services departing from Lisbon - Oriente and arriving at Alcaudete de la Jara via Badajoz and Talavera de la Reina.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 47m.
No, there is no direct train from Lisbon to Sierra de Gata (Land). However, there are services departing from Lisboa Oriente and arriving at Talavera De La Reina via Entroncamento and Badajoz.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 54m.
The distance between Lisbon and Sierra de Gata (Land) is 561 km. The road distance is 487.6 km.
The best way to get from Lisbon to Sierra de Gata (Land) without a car is to bus which takes 9h 47m and costs €70 - €120.
It takes approximately 9h 47m to get from Lisbon to Sierra de Gata (Land), including transfers.
Lisbon to Sierra de Gata (Land) b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, depart from Lisbon - Oriente station.
Lisbon to Sierra de Gata (Land) train services, operated by Comboios de Portugal, depart from Lisboa Oriente station.
The best way to get from Lisbon to Sierra de Gata (Land) is to bus which takes 9h 47m and costs €70 - €120. Alternatively, you can train, which costs €100 - €170 and takes 9h 54m.
